Python Developer (Full Stack Developer)

ClearRoute
Charing Cross, United Kingdom
20 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
£ 73K

Job location

Charing Cross, United Kingdom

Tech stack

JavaScript
API
Artificial Intelligence
Azure
Big Data
Django
Python
Performance Tuning
Systems Integration
Web Applications
Data Processing
React
Flask
Large Language Models
Backend
FastAPI
Angular
Cosmos DB
Front End Software Development
REST
Data Pipelines
Docker
Microservices

Job description

We are seeking an experienced Python Full Stack Developer with experience in Azure. The ideal candidate will have hands-on experience building and deploying scalable web applications using Python (Django/FastAPI/Flask) on the backend and modern JavaScript frameworks (React or Angular) on the frontend.

In addition to full-stack development, you'll work with AI-driven components, including Agentic AI systems, LLM integrations, and automation services on Azure. You'll be expected to build and optimize applications that handle large volumes of data, supporting both performance and intelligence at scale., Design, develop, and maintain end-to-end web applications using Python for backend and modern JavaScript frameworks for frontend.

Build and manage RESTful APIs and microservices with a focus on scalability, performance, and security.

Deploy, monitor, and optimize applications on Azure.

Integrate AI/ML capabilities - including Agentic AI, LLMs (e.g., OpenAI, Azure OpenAI), and Azure Cognitive Services - into application workflows.

Work with data-rich systems, optimizing data pipelines and backend processes for large-scale data handling and real-time processing.

Deploy, monitor, and optimize applications on Microsoft Azure, leveraging App Service, Functions, Cosmos DB, Key Vault, and related services.

Requirements

Circa 8 years of experience in Python, using frameworks such as Django, Flask, or FastAPI.

Frontend development experience using React or Angular.

Proven experience deploying and maintaining applications on Microsoft Azure.

Familiarity with AI systems, Agentic AI workflows, or integrating LLM APIs (OpenAI, Azure OpenAI, Anthropic, etc.).

Experience handling large-scale data processing, data transformations, and performance optimization.

Familiarity with Docker and containerized deployments.

Strong analytical and problem-solving skills, with attention to performance and scalability.

About the company

ClearRoute is an is an engineering consultancy bridging Quality Engineering, Cloud Platforms and Developer Experience. We work with technology leaders facing complex business challenges. We take as much pride in our people, culture and work-life balance as we do in making better software. We're not just making better software. We're making the making of software better. Collaborative, entrepreneurial and dedicated to problem-Solving, we bring the step change our customer need to sustain innovation. Our values challenge us to do the best we can for ClearRoute, our customers and most importantly our team. We want to create a collaborative team to help build ClearRoute. This is an opportunity for you to build the organization from the ground up, use your voice to drive change and help transform organisations and problem domains.

Apply for this position